| 1 | GENETIC DIVERSITY AMONG CHINESE SIKA DEER (CERVUS NIPPON) POPULATIONS AND RELATIONSHIPS BETWEEN CHINESE AND JAPANESE SIKA DEER显示文摘Sika deer (Cervus nippon) is a cervid endemic to mainland and insular Asia and endan-gered. We analyzed variation in the mitochondrial DNA (mtDNA) control region for four subspecies to understand the genetic diversity, population structure and evolutionary history in China. 335 bp were se-quenced and eight haplotypes were identified based on 25 variable sites among the populations. Sika deer in China showed lower genetic diversity, sug-gesting a small effective population size due to habi-tat fragmentation, a low number of founder individu-als, or the narrow breeding program. AMOVA analy-sis indicated that there was significant genetic subdi-vision among the four populations, but no correlation between the genetic and geographic distance. Phy-logenetic analyses also revealed that Chinese sika deer may be divided into three genetic clades, but the genetic structure among Chinese populations was inconsistent with subspecies designations and pre-sent geographic distribution. Including the sequence data of Japanese sika deer, the results indicated that Chinese populations were more closely related to Southern Japanese populations than to the Northern Japanese one, and the Taiwan population was closer to populations of Northeastern China and Sichuan than to those of Southern China. | Lü Xiaoping WEI Fuwen LIMing YANG Guang LIU Hai | 2006 | Chinese Science Bulletin2006,51,4: | 7 |
| 2 | Chinese medicine formulas for nonalcoholic fatty liver disease: Overview of systematic reviews显示文摘BACKGROUND Nonalcoholic fatty liver disease(NAFLD)affects more than one-quarter of the global population.Due to the lack of approved chemical agents,many patients seek treatment from traditional Chinese medicine(TCM)formulas.A variety of systematic reviews have been published regarding the effectiveness and safety of TCM formulas for NAFLD.AIM To critically appraise available systematic reviews and sort out the high-quality evidence on TCM formulas for the management of NAFLD.METHODS Seven databases were systematically searched from their inception to 28 February 2020.The search terms included“non-alcoholic fatty liver disease,”“Chinese medicines,”“systematic review,”and their synonyms.Systematic reviews involving TCM formulas alone or in combination with conventional medications were included.The methodological quality and risk of bias of eligible systematic reviews were evaluated by using A Measure Tool to Assess Systematic Reviews 2(AMSTAR 2)and Risk of Bias in Systematic Review(ROBIS).The quality of outcomes was assessed by the Grading of Recommendations Assessment,Development and Evaluation(GRADE)system.RESULTS Seven systematic reviews were ultimately included.All systematic reviews were conducted based on randomized controlled trials and published in the last decade.According to the AMSTAR 2 tool,one systematic review was judged as having a moderate confidence level,whereas the other studies were rated as having a low or extremely low level of confidence.The ROBIS tool showed that the included systematic reviews all had a high risk of bias due to insufficient consideration of identified concerns.According to the GRADE system,only two outcomes were determined as high quality;namely,TCM formulas with the HuoXueHuaYu principle were better than conventional medications in ultrasound improvement,and TCM formulas were superior to antioxidants in alanine aminotransferase normalization.Other outcomes were downgraded to lower levels,mainly because of heterogeneity among studies,not meeting optimal information sample size,and inclusion of excessive numbers of small sample studies.Nevertheless,the evidence quality of extracted outcomes should be further downgraded when applying to clinical practice due to indirectness.CONCLUSION The quality of available systematic reviews was not satisfactory.Researchers should avoid repeatedly conducting systematic reviews in this area and focus on designing rigorous randomized controlled trials to support TCM formula applications. | Liang Dai Wen-Jun Zhou Linda L D Zhong Xu-Dong Tang Guang Ji | 2021 | World Journal of Clinical Cases2021,9,1: | 3 |
| 3 | QTL effects and epistatic interaction for flowering time and branch number in a soybean mapping population of Japanese×Chinese cultivars显示文摘Flowering time and branching type are important agronomic traits related to the adaptability and yield of soybean. Molecular bases for major flowering time or maturity loci, E1 to E4, have been identified. However, more flowering time genes in cultivars with different genetic backgrounds are needed to be mapped and cloned for a better understanding of flowering time regulation in soybean. In this study, we developed a population of Japanese cultivar(Toyomusume)×Chinese cultivar(Suinong 10) to map novel quantitative trait locus(QTL) for flowering time and branch number. A genetic linkage map of a F_2 population was constructed using 1 306 polymorphic single nucleotide polymorphism(SNP) markers using Illumina Soy SNP8 ki Select Bead Chip containing 7 189(SNPs). Two major QTLs at E1 and E9, and two minor QTLs at a novel locus, qFT2_1 and at E3 region were mapped. Using other sets of F_2 populations and their derived progenies, the existence of a novel QTL of qFT2_1 was verified. qBR6_1, the major QTL for branch number was mapped to the proximate to the E1 gene, inferring that E1 gene or neighboring genetic factor is significantly contributing to the branch number. | YANG Guang ZHAI Hong WU Hong-yan ZHANG Xing-zheng LüShi-xiang WANG Ya-ying LI Yu-qiu HU Bo WANG Lu WEN Zi-xiang WANG De-chun WANG Shao-dong Kyuya Harada XIA Zheng-jun XIE Fu-ti | 2017 | Journal of Integrative Agriculture2017,16,9: | 3 |
| 4 | A 3D Geological Model Constrained by Gravity and Magnetic Inversion and its Exploration Implications for the World-class Zhuxi Tungsten Deposit, South China显示文摘The Zhuxi tungsten deposit in Jiangxi Province,South China,contains a total W reserve of about 2.86 Mt at an average grade of 0.54 wt%WO3,representing the largest W deposit in the world.Numerous studies on the metallogeny of the deposit have included its timing,the ore-controlling structures and sedimentary host rocks and their implications for mineral exploration.However,the deep nappe structural style of Taqian-Fuchun metallogenic belt that hosts the W deposit,and the spatial shape and scale of deeply concealed intrusions and their sedimentary host rocks are still poorly defined,which seriously restricts the discovery of new deposits at depth and in surrounding areas of the W deposit.Modern 3 D geological modeling is an important tool for the exploration of concealed orebodies,especially in brownfield environments.There are obvious density contrast and weak magnetic contrast in the ore-controlling strata and granite at the periphery of the deposit,which lays a physical foundation for solving the 3 D spatial problems of the ore-controlling geological body in the deep part of the study area through gravity and magnetic modeling.Gravity data(1:50000)and aeromagnetic data(1:50000)from the latest geophysical surveys of 2016-2018 have been used,firstly,to carry out a potential field separation to obtain residual anomalies for gravity and magnetic interactive inversion.Then,on the basis of the analysis of the relationship between physical properties and lithology,under the constraints of surface geology and borehole data,human-computer interactive gravity and magnetic inversion for 18 cross-sections were completed.Finally,the 3 D geological model of the Zhuxi tungsten deposit and its periphery have been established through these 18 sections,and the spatial shape of the intrusions and strata with a depth of 5 km underground were obtained,initially realizing―transparency‖for ore-controlling bodies.According the analysis of the geophysical,geochemical,and geological characteristics of the Zhuxi tungsten deposit,we discern three principles for prospecting and prediction in the research area,and propose five new exploration targets in its periphery. | YAN Jiayong LÜ Qingtian QI Guang FU Guangming ZHANG Kun LAN Xueyi GUO Xin WEI Jin LUO Fan WANG Hao WANG Xu | 2020 | Acta Geologica Sinica(English Edition)2020,94,6: | 3 |
